31/*
32 * This module provides MI support for per-cpu data.
33 *
34 * Each architecture determines the mapping of logical CPU IDs to physical
35 * CPUs.  The requirements of this mapping are as follows:
36 *  - Logical CPU IDs must reside in the range 0 ... MAXCPU - 1.
37 *  - The mapping is not required to be dense.  That is, there may be
38 *    gaps in the mappings.
39 *  - The platform sets the value of MAXCPU in <machine/param.h>.
40 *  - It is suggested, but not required, that in the non-SMP case, the
41 *    platform define MAXCPU to be 1 and define the logical ID of the
42 *    sole CPU as 0.
43 */

58static struct pcpu *cpuid_to_pcpu[MAXCPU];
59struct cpuhead cpuhead = SLIST_HEAD_INITIALIZER(cpuhead);
60
61/*
62 * Initialize the MI portions of a struct pcpu.
63 */
64void
65pcpu_init(struct pcpu *pcpu, int cpuid, size_t size)
66{
67
68	bzero(pcpu, size);
69	KASSERT(cpuid >= 0 && cpuid < MAXCPU,
70	    ("pcpu_init: invalid cpuid %d", cpuid));
71	pcpu->pc_cpuid = cpuid;
72	pcpu->pc_cpumask = 1 << cpuid;
73	cpuid_to_pcpu[cpuid] = pcpu;
74	SLIST_INSERT_HEAD(&cpuhead, pcpu, pc_allcpu);
75	cpu_pcpu_init(pcpu, cpuid, size);
76}
77
78/*
79 * Destroy a struct pcpu.
80 */
81void
82pcpu_destroy(struct pcpu *pcpu)
83{
84
85	SLIST_REMOVE(&cpuhead, pcpu, pcpu, pc_allcpu);
86	cpuid_to_pcpu[pcpu->pc_cpuid] = NULL;
87}
88
89/*
90 * Locate a struct pcpu by cpu id.
91 */
92struct pcpu *
93pcpu_find(u_int cpuid)
94{
95
96	return (cpuid_to_pcpu[cpuid]);
97}
